## Support

RateGate checks hotel rate parity across partner feeds. Contractors: read CONTRIBUTING first. Bugs go in the tracker with the "ratecheck" label; include the feed ID and a timestamp or it gets bounced back. Feature requests are triaged Mondays. Don't ping individual engineers directly. Staging credentials come from the Oakhollow ops desk, not from this repo. Anything urgent — parity breaches on live inventory — skips the tracker entirely and goes straight to the address below.

escalation mailbox, bafog-fafog: ulador@paliqlabs.internal

**Ticket: Vault locked after session-token refresh failure**

Several Coppermine Vault users report being locked out when their session token expires mid-refresh. The client retries with the stale token, which trips the lockout counter and seals the vault for 24 hours. Engineering has confirmed the race condition in the refresh handler; a fix ships in build 4.2.1. Until then, support may manually unseal affected vaults from the admin console. To authorize the unseal step, enter the recovery passphrase below.

recovery phrase for bawef-haduf: wenax-druox-julmir

## Break-Glass Access: CharsetProbe Service

If the CharsetProbe encoding-detection service for uploaded text files fails during a release cut, the release manager may invoke break-glass access to the Tollgate admin vault. Verify the BOM-sniffing fallback is disabled first, then confirm two approvers in the Lanternworks on-call channel. Once approved, unseal the vault with the recovery passphrase below.

unlock words, kagef-taduf: fenir-quenix-norwyn-sorvan-gormir-gorir-fraok

Quarterly Planning Note — Divestiture of the Coastal Tooling Unit

For the finance team: the sale of the Coastal Tooling unit to Pellmark Industries remains on track for close in Q3. Please finalize the carve-out balance sheet, reconcile intercompany positions, and prepare the working-capital adjustment schedule by month-end. Audit support requests should be prioritized. For planning purposes, note the following sensitive item:

internal memo for hawef-kahif: The finance team signed off on a budget of $25.9 million for Project Sorox. The renewal with Pelokek Logistics closes at $51.7 million a year, 52 percent below the last contract.